What is a virtual call center?

A virtual call center is a customer service operation where agents work remotely rather than from a centralized physical location. These agents use internet-based software to handle inbound and outbound calls, as well as other customer interactions like emails or chats. Virtual call centers allow companies to employ staff from different locations, often improving flexibility and reducing overhead costs. They are commonly used in industries such as telecommunications, retail, and technical support.

What are virtual call center jobs?

Virtual call center jobs focus on providing phone service in a variety of fields. While many people associate them with telemarketing and customer service, companies also use virtual call centers for things like setting appointments. In this role, you may help manage inbound and outbound calls, coordinate with other employees to find solutions to customer issues, and provide additional assistance or answer customer questions as needed. Many virtual call centers focus on a specific field. For example, a company may provide financial services or remote healthcare through a virtual call center. Virtual call centers frequently allow you to work from home.

What are some common challenges faced by employees in a virtual call center, and how can they be managed?

One common challenge in a virtual call center is staying focused and motivated while working remotely, often in a home environment with potential distractions. Additionally, communicating effectively with team members and supervisors can be more difficult without face-to-face interaction. To manage these challenges, it's helpful to establish a dedicated, quiet workspace, use reliable communication tools, and participate in regular team meetings. Many companies also offer training and support resources to help employees remain connected and productive.

Primary Function:
The Call Center Representative Level I provides exceptional and consistent customer service to all customers calling UCHC's Call Center or walking in for services. The Call Center Representative ensures that all callers or walk-ins to UCHC experience timely, accurate, and comprehensive service and responses to their inquiries or reason for call/walk-in. The Representative follows all call and walk-in protocols as trained, including appropriate greeting, answering and handling of calls and/or walk-ins, patient identification, demographic, account, and insurance verification, PCP assignment, appointment history review and scheduling protocols, telephone encounter documentation, and accurate and complete data entry and documentation in all computer systems, including the Electronic Medical Record (EMR) system.
The Call Center Representative should have the ability to perform all emergency protocols, such as call codes and appropriate use of the overhead emergency paging system, and make patient outreach from assigned work queues, My Chart referrals, after-hours answering service follow up, and reminder calls. The person in this position supports multiple clinical departments, such as Primary Care, Urgent Care, Ob/Gyn, Teen Clinic Specialties, etc. and follows all health center policies and procedures on patient confidentiality/HIPAA and all health center-wide guidelines.
